SF troopers neutralize Abu Sayyaf fighters


By Francis Wakefield

Four Abu Sayyaf militants under Mundi Sawadjaan were slain while five others were wounded in a ferocious gunfight with soldiers of 6th Special Forces Battalion in Patikul, Sulu on Thursday, February 14.

Brigadier General Divino Rey Pabayo, the Joint Task Force Sulu Commander, said two militants died on the spot while two died due to blood loss.

“The Abu Sayyaf is unwilling to engage government troops due to their recent losses in men and supplies,” he added.

Meanwhile, Sergeant Allan Bambino Caday and Sergeant Wilfredo Flores were discharged from confinement at Kuta Heneral Teodulfo Bautista Hospital.

Sergeant Caday and Sergeant Flores both suffered shrapnel wounds during the 20-minute gunfight in Barangay Igasan at 11:30 a.m.

“Troops are advancing upon their objective as deliberate fire and combat operations continue against terrorists in Sulu,” said Lieutenant General Arnel Dela Vega, the commander of the Western Mindanao Command.
